Be empathetic towards others from "summary" of How to Win Friends and Influence People by Dale Carnegie
To understand the concept of empathy, we must first put ourselves in the shoes of others. Empathy is about being able to see the world from someone else's perspective, to understand their feelings and emotions. It is about being able to connect with others on a deeper level, beyond just surface interactions. When we are empathetic towards others, we show that we care about their well-being and are willing to listen to their thoughts and feelings. This fosters a sense of trust and understanding in our relationships with others. By being empathetic, we can build stronger connections with those around us and create a more positive and supportive environment.
